What is Turbo Housing?
Turbo housing, also known as turbine housing, is the component of a turbocharger that contains the turbine wheel and directs exhaust gases onto it. This housing is integral to the turbocharger’s operation, as it affects characteristics such as efficiency, spool time, and overall performance. The design and material of the turbo housing can significantly influence the performance capabilities of the turbocharger system.
